Media Cloud - Virtual HeadEndLessons learned

Organizational challenges:

– Vendor management (working mode with Vendors).

– Mindset of the project staff.

– Transforming engineers into the new "cloud" world.

– Operation of two environments (legacy and cloud).

– Knowledge and the experience (combined application with infrastructure and network)

– Organization and processes .

Technological challenges:

– Working on the bleeding edge of the technology.

– Technology unknowns.

– Infrastructure : very large high performance media cloud solution.

– Zero packet loss in cloud environment with the multicast.

Enterprise cloud vs. virtual Headend workloads

1. CPU, RAM or Storage bound performance

2. Aggregated view of resources(CPU, Memory, resources overcommitted)

3. Endpoints(Applications need the OS)

4. Many and small virtual machines

1. CPU & I/O bound performance(DPDK, SR-IOV, etc.)

2. Enhanced platform awareness(Internal Architecture relevant for guests)

3. Middlepoints(Data-plane network bypass the OS)

4. Fewer and larger VMs

IT Cloud Virtual Headend

Containers in VMs vs. Baremetal

• The transcoding applications from Ateme and

Harmonic are provided in Docker containers

• We decided to put the containers into a virtual machine

• Why?

• Docker Networking

• Hardware independence

• VM as “bridge” between application and physical

environment

• Management and Monitoring

• Virtualization Overhead: 5-10 %

• Additional Component (Guest OS) to be managed

• Cost of Hypervisor Physical Server Physical Server

Docker Networking

–net=bridge:

• Container is connected with the Network Bridge

• Same IP addresses per Host, 1 NIC only

• Standard Mode

–net=none:

• No network connection of the container (i.e. for number

crunchers, batch jobs, etc.)

–net=container:<CONTAINER | ID>:

• Container is using the NW connection of a “neighbor”

• Allow reachability of multiple segregated processes that

under the same IP

–net=host:

• Container has direct access to physical NICs of the hos

Multicast in OpenStack

• No multicast available out-of-the-box

• Virtual layer-2 switches support IGMP snooping:

– Open vSwitch 2.5 supports IGMP snooping

– Open vSwitch 2.7 contains bugfixes to enable multicast with multiple provider VLANs

–http://openvswitch.org/features/

–https://github.com/openvswitch/ovs/blob/master/FAQ.md

– Linux Bridge 2.4 supports IGMP snopping

–http://www.linuxfoundation.org/collaborate/workgroups/networking/bridge#Snooping

20

Page 21: OpenStack - based NFV Cloud at Swisscom · –Transforming engineers into the new "cloud" world. –Operation of two environments (legacy and cloud). –Knowledge and the experience

Multicast in OpenStack – recommendations

• Neutron provider network:

• Don’t use Neutron-L3-Agent

• Neutron does not route any multicast traffic

• Use Neutron provider network

• Use routable public VLAN configured on top-of-rack switches

• Use router outside OpenStack

• Use gateway outside OpenStack

• Attach Nova instances directly to provider network

• Configure multicast routing / PIM on the physical router
